Web1 Dec 2016 · Cortical bone is a dense mineralised tissue that encloses trabecular bone in epiphyses and is also found in diaphyses of long bones. It consists mainly of concentric bone lamellae arranged around blood vessels forming osteons and interstitial areas [31]. WebTensile and Compressive Strength As mentioned previously , bones such as the femur are subjected to bending moments during normal loading. These create both tensile and compressive stresses in different regions of the bone.

WebA porous composite model is developed to analyze the tensile mechanical properties of cortical bone. The effects of microporosity (volksman's canals, osteocyte lacunae) on the mechanical properties of bone tissue are taken into account. Web7 Apr 2024 · The above analysis results show that the tensile strength of the multi-layer composite with fiber helix angle of 30° is stronger. Simultaneously, it also shows that the helix structure of collagen fibers with a helix angle of 30° in osteon helps to enhance the tensile strength of cortical bone.
